Community health worker Community Health Workers

職業代碼: 21-1094(SOC) 非技術移民職業 總體 7.4/10

Community health workers promote health within communities, help individuals adopt healthy behaviors, act as advocates to help residents communicate with medical or social service agencies, and implement programs that promote individual and community health.

In the AI era: what happens to Community health worker

Amplified by AI

Community health workers' core value lies in interpersonal trust and localized services; AI cannot easily replace their emotional support and community liaison functions. However, administrative tasks such as data management and educational material generation will be greatly enhanced by AI, requiring practitioners to shift to higher-value personalized guidance roles.

Entry-level outlook

Entry-level positions have not narrowed significantly, but basic information distribution roles have decreased; job seekers with digital tools and data analysis skills have an advantage, while competition for purely executional roles has intensified.

🚀 How to level up in the AI era

Transition to community health technology specialist, leading the implementation of AI tools in health assessment, educational materials, and client management; or advance to health program coordinator, using data analysis to optimize project outcomes; also possible to develop into health coach or public health analyst, focusing on high-value consulting and complex case management.

職業前景

Career path can progress from entry-level worker to project coordinator or supervisor, or through continuing education become a health educator or public health specialist.

The US Bureau of Labor Statistics projects about 14% employment growth from 2023 to 2033, much faster than average, driven by community health emphasis and an aging population.

常見問題

What are the salary prospects for community health workers?
Salary is relatively low; entry-level around $30,000-40,000, senior up to $50,000-60,000, but job satisfaction is high.
Can community health workers immigrate to the US?
Skilled migration paths are very limited. This occupation typically doesn't require a bachelor's degree; H-1B and EB-3 green card applications are difficult, and employer sponsorship opportunities are few.
